In a move reflecting the accelerating pace of innovation in the med-tech sector, Medtronic has expanded its surgical solutions footprint across Europe. The company received CE mark approval to utilize its Stealth AXiS surgical navigation system for ear, nose, and throat (ENT) procedures. This expansion follows previous approvals for spine and cranial applications, as Medtronic aims to capture a larger share of the European surgical robotics and navigation market.
